verb
- to control or operate (a machine or process) automatically using a computer or electronic system
Usage: technical; often used in industrial or manufacturing contexts
Examples
- The factory decided to cybernate its assembly line to increase efficiency.
- Modern plants cybernate most of their production processes.
- Engineers worked to cybernate the warehouse inventory system.
- The company cybernated its quality control checks using advanced sensors.
- Cybernating the heating system reduced energy costs significantly.
